UNCTAD · World Investment Report 2026
One chart explains where global investment money actually went — and why data centres dominated the year.
Largest sector swing
+$235B
Data centres · 2024→2025
In 2025 the global investment map rearranged itself around a single sector. Capital flooded into data centres while renewables, infrastructure, and manufacturing saw meaningful pullbacks. The chart below condenses UNCTAD Figure I.19 — the report's most cited visualization of the year.
